As the official caterers for the Elton John AIDS Foundation Academy Awards Viewing Party for the 15 th year, Chef Wayne Elias will create a unparalleled five-course dining experience at West Hollywood Park on Sunday, February 24, 2019.


This one-thousand-meal massive undertaking will be seamlessly executed in three hours by a team of over 150 Crumble Catering staffers tasked with serving Hollywood’s biggest A-listers.
 
When it comes to a mouth-watering and inspiring cuisine, Chef Wayne and his business partner of 28 years Chris Diamond, co-owners of Crumble Catering and the Los Feliz restaurant Rockwell: Table & Stage, are truly Hollywood’s “go-to” team. Diamond remarked, “We love creating a magical experience for the Foundation guests – as it is not only a celebratory night for Hollywood, but a vital cause-driven night for raising funds!”
 
The planning for this year’s party literally commences at the conclusion of the previous year. Chef Wayne works hand-in-hand with Diamond and his team of sous-chefs and the Foundation to create a one-of-a-kind-menu for the festive gathering of VIPs and donors.
 
As in the past, this sumptuous five-course dinner will be served on-site with mammoth digital screens
broadcasting the Oscar telecast live, while fund-raising activities happen during commercial-breaks.
West Hollywood Park is literally transformed into fantasy city-within-a-city, with a sprawling array of
custom-built connecting pavilions featuring sparkling custom one-night-only décor, state of the art
lighting, projection, and displays. The army of 150 servers and bartenders are supplemented by a kitchen
staff of 70 to make the split-second timing and execution for the night simply flawless.
 
Elias commented, “We are excited to lead the way this year with a menu that will delight the senses and please the palates of this discerning and generous group of patrons.” Adding, “It truly is one of the most exciting moments for my team and always a night to remember, knowing that so many individuals are benefiting around the globe.”
 
Since 1992, the Elton John AIDS Foundation has raised over $400 million for people affected by the epidemic, helping prevent infections, provide treatment and services, and motivate governments to end AIDS.

THE KING CUATRO

Ingredients:

  • 1.5 parts BACARDÍ Añejo Cuatro
  • 0.75 part Fresh Lemon Juice
  • 0.5 part St. Germain Elderflower Liqueur
  • 0.25 part Honey
  • 2 Blackberries
  • MARTINI & ROSSI Prosecco

Method: Muddle blackberries in a tin, and pour all cocktail ingredients in. Shake and strain into coupe glass. Top with MARTINI & ROSSI Prosecco and garnish with a Blackberry-speared purple orchid.

Award Winning Orchard

Ingredients:

  • 2 oz. Angry Orchard Crisp Apple
  • 1 oz. St. Germain
  • 2 oz. Champagne

Directions:

  • Build in a champagne flute and garnish with a lemon twist.
